How can you find out what is in Natural Herbal Supplements?

This information must be included on supplement labels

  • Name of the supplement

  • Name and address for the manufacturer/distributor

  • Here is a complete list of ingredients

  • Serving size, active ingredient and amount

Ask your pharmacist or doctor if you are unsure about something on the label.

The Dietary Supplement Label Database is a great way to find out the products’ ingredients. It is accessible on the U.S. National Institute of Health website. You can search for products by brand, manufacturer, use, active ingredient, or manufacturer.

How can you tell if claims about supplementation are valid?

Natural Herbal Supplement manufacturers are responsible for ensuring that claims about their products don’t come across as misleading or false and that evidence backs them up. They are not required to provide this evidence to the FDA.

Be a smart buyer. Don’t rely solely on the product’s marketing. To evaluate a product’s claims, look for objective, scientifically-based information.

Talk to your doctor or pharmacist about any supplement:

They may be able to point you in the right direction regarding its use and potential side effects.

Search for scientific research findings :

The National Center for Complementary and Integrative Health and the Office of Dietary Supplements are two good sources in the U.S. Both websites can help consumers make informed decisions about dietary supplements.

Call the manufacturer :

For questions regarding a product, contact the distributor or manufacturer. Talk to someone who can answer your questions. For example, what data does the company have to support product claims?
